WebA manual thermostat needs to be fixed to the wall to work properly. It operates by using a mechanical device to detect changes in room temperature. When it does, it triggers a metal coil inside the thermostat to move and connect or disconnect the electric circuit.

If in doubt, contact an HVAC professional. WebOct 25, 2014 · The popular Nest thermostat claims to work without a C-wire, there are some caveats. Without a C-wire, the Nest gets its power from your heating or cooling system… assuming it’s running. When it’s not running, the Nest still needs to get power. The Nest will “pulse” the heat wire, turning on the furnace to pull a bit of power to keep ...
